Uniform Circular Motion
Uniform circular motion could be elaborates as the motion of an object within a circle at a constant speed. As an object moves within a circle, it is continually changing its direction. At all examples, the object is moving tangent to the circle. Because the direction of the velocity vector is the similar as the direction of the object's motion and the velocity vector is directed tangent to the circle as well.
